Quinoa salad with shredded greens & raisins

Quinoa Salad with Shredded Greens & Raisins is a vibrant and nutritious dish that brings together the wholesome goodness of quinoa, fresh greens, and sweet raisins. This salad is perfect for a light lunch, a side dish at dinner, or as a meal prep option for busy weeks. With its delightful combination of textures and flavors, this salad is not only healthy but also satisfying and delicious. Let’s explore how to prepare this colorful salad and what makes it special.

Ingredients You’ll Need

To create Quinoa Salad with Shredded Greens & Raisins, gather the following ingredients:

  • Quinoa: The star of this salad, quinoa is a gluten-free grain rich in protein, fiber, and essential nutrients. Use any variety, such as white, red, or black quinoa.
  • Fresh Greens: Choose a mix of shredded greens like kale, spinach, or Swiss chard for a nutrient boost. These greens add a vibrant color and a variety of flavors.
  • Raisins: Sweet raisins provide a lovely contrast to the savory elements of the salad. They add natural sweetness and chewy texture.
  • Vegetables: Include diced vegetables like cucumbers, bell peppers, or carrots for extra crunch and nutrition.
  • Nuts or Seeds: Optional but highly recommended, nuts or seeds like almonds, walnuts, or sunflower seeds add healthy fats and a satisfying crunch.
  • Fresh Herbs: Chopped fresh herbs like parsley, cilantro, or mint enhance the flavor and freshness of the salad.
  • Olive Oil: Extra virgin olive oil acts as a dressing base, providing richness and flavor.
  • Lemon Juice: Fresh lemon juice brightens the salad, adding acidity and balancing the flavors.
  • Salt and Pepper: Essential for seasoning the salad.

How to Make Quinoa Salad with Shredded Greens & Raisins

Creating this flavorful salad is simple and quick. Follow these steps for a delicious result:

  1. Cook the Quinoa: Rinse 1 cup of quinoa under cold water to remove any bitterness. In a medium saucepan, combine the rinsed quinoa with 2 cups of water or vegetable broth.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at to low, cover, and simmer for about 15 minutes, or until the quinoa is fluffy and the water is absorbed. Remove from heat and let it cool.
  2. Prepare the Vegetables and Greens: While the quinoa is cooking, wash and shred the greens of your choice. Dice any additional vegetables you’re using, such as cucumbers or bell peppers.
  3. Make the Dressing: In a small bowl, whisk together olive oil, fresh lemon juice, salt, and pepper. Adjust the seasoning according to your taste preference.
  4. Combine the Ingredients: In a large mixing bowl, combine the cooked and cooled quinoa, shredded greens, diced vegetables, raisins, and chopped nuts or seeds (if using). Drizzle the dressing over the salad and toss gently to combine.
  5. Garnish and Serve: Add fresh herbs and give the salad one last gentle toss. Serve immediately or let it chill in the refrigerator for 30 minutes to allow the flavors to meld.

Tips for Perfect Quinoa Salad

To ensure your Quinoa Salad with Shredded Greens & Raisins is fresh and flavorful, consider the following tips:

  • Rinse the Quinoa: Rinsing quinoa before cooking removes the saponins, which can give a bitter taste.
  • Customize Your Ingredients: Feel free to adjust the vegetables, greens, and nuts based on your preferences or what you have on hand.
  • Let It Chill: Allowing the salad to sit for a while before serving enhances the flavors as they mingle together.

Serving Suggestions

Quinoa Salad with Shredded Greens & Raisins is versatile and can be served in various ways:

  • As a Main Dish: Enjoy the salad on its own for a light lunch or dinner option.
  • As a Side Dish: Pair with grilled chicken, fish, or other protein for a balanced meal.
  • In a Wrap: Use the salad as a filling for wraps or pita bread for a quick and healthy lunch.

Variations on the Recipe

Get creative with your Quinoa Salad by trying these variations:

  • Add Protein: Incorporate chickpeas, black beans, or grilled chicken to make the salad more filling.
  • Different Dried Fruits: Substitute raisins with dried cranberries, apricots, or chopped dates for a unique flavor.
  • Spicy Kick: Add diced jalapeños or a sprinkle of cayenne pepper for a spicy twist.

Storing Leftovers

Store any leftover quinoa salad in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3-4 days. The flavors will continue to develop, making it even tastier the next day.
